What Key Features Should Women Look for in Jungle Boots?

When searching for the best jungle boots for women, several key features should be considered to ensure comfort, durability, and performance in challenging terrains.

  • Water Resistance: Jungle environments are often wet, so a good pair of jungle boots should have water-resistant or waterproof materials. This feature helps keep feet dry and comfortable, reducing the risk of blisters and fungal infections.
  • Breathability: Proper ventilation is crucial in humid climates, and boots with breathable materials or mesh panels allow moisture to escape. This helps to regulate temperature and keeps feet cool, preventing overheating during strenuous activities.
  • Traction and Grip: The outsole of jungle boots should provide excellent traction on slippery surfaces like mud and wet rocks. A lugged sole with deep treads enhances grip, which is essential for stability and safety while navigating through challenging terrain.
  • Ankle Support: Boots that offer good ankle support can prevent injuries during treks in uneven areas. High-top styles typically provide better support and stability, which is especially important when carrying heavy loads or walking on rugged paths.
  • Lightweight Construction: Lighter boots reduce fatigue and allow for greater agility, making them ideal for long hikes or extended wear. A lightweight design does not compromise durability, but ensures comfort over long distances.
  • Durable Material: Jungle boots should be constructed from tough materials like nylon or leather that can withstand rough terrain and resist abrasions. Durability ensures that the boots will last through multiple adventures without significant wear and tear.
  • Comfortable Fit: A well-fitted boot is crucial for long-term comfort, so look for options with adjustable features like laces or straps. Additionally, cushioned insoles can enhance comfort for extended periods of wear, reducing the likelihood of foot fatigue.
  • Quick-Drying: Since jungle conditions can lead to wet feet, boots made from quick-drying materials help prevent discomfort and the development of odors. This feature is particularly beneficial for those who may encounter water crossings or rain.

How Do Different Materials Impact the Performance of Jungle Boots?

The performance of jungle boots can be significantly influenced by the materials used in their construction.

  • Upper Material: The upper part of jungle boots is often made from a combination of nylon and leather. Nylon is lightweight, quick-drying, and breathable, making it ideal for wet conditions, while leather offers durability and protection against abrasions.
  • Outsole Material: The outsoles of jungle boots are typically crafted from rubber, which provides excellent traction on slippery surfaces. The compound used can affect the boot’s grip, durability, and flexibility, making it essential for navigating through diverse jungle terrains.
  • Insulation: Some jungle boots include insulation materials, which can impact warmth and comfort in cooler environments. Materials like neoprene or specialized insulative linings can help regulate temperature while maintaining breathability to prevent overheating.
  • Waterproofing: The presence of waterproof materials, such as Gore-Tex or similar membranes, can greatly enhance a boot’s performance in wet conditions. These materials allow for moisture to escape while keeping water from entering, ensuring that feet stay dry during prolonged exposure to damp environments.
  • Cushioning and Support: The use of EVA foam or other cushioning materials in the midsole affects shock absorption and comfort. Adequate cushioning can prevent fatigue during long treks, while arch support helps maintain foot health over uneven terrain.

What Are Common Sizing Tips to Consider for Jungle Boots?

When selecting the best jungle boots for women, there are several sizing tips to keep in mind for optimal comfort and performance.

  • Measure Your Feet: Always measure both feet to determine the correct size, as one foot may be larger than the other. Use a ruler or a specialized foot measuring device to find the length and width, ensuring that you account for any specific foot conditions like flat feet or high arches.
  • Consider Sock Thickness: The type of socks you plan to wear can significantly affect boot sizing. If you opt for thicker socks for added warmth and cushioning, it’s wise to choose a half size larger to accommodate the extra bulk without sacrificing comfort.
  • Check for a Snug Fit: Jungle boots should feel snug but not overly tight, particularly around the heel and arch areas. This fit helps prevent blisters and ensures the boot stays securely on your foot during movement, which is crucial in rugged environments.
  • Look for Adjustable Features: Features like laces, buckles, or adjustable straps can provide a more customized fit. These allow you to tighten or loosen the boot as needed, which can be especially beneficial when trekking through varying terrain.
  • Break-In Period: Be aware that jungle boots may require a break-in period. It’s advisable to wear them for short periods before embarking on longer excursions to allow the materials to conform to your feet comfortably.
  • Read Reviews: Customer reviews can provide insights into how a particular brand or model fits. Look for comments regarding sizing consistency, comfort levels, and any necessary adjustments that previous buyers recommend.

How Can Women Accommodate for Special Foot Considerations in Jungle Boots?

Women can accommodate for special foot considerations in jungle boots by focusing on fit, materials, and specific design features.

  • Proper Sizing: Ensuring the right size is crucial, as jungle boots often come in unisex sizes that may not fit women’s feet accurately.
  • Arch Support: Selecting boots with adequate arch support is essential for comfort during long treks, especially for those with high or low arches.
  • Breathable Materials: Opting for boots made from breathable materials can help prevent overheating and sweating, which is particularly important in humid jungle environments.
  • Weight Distribution: Choosing lightweight boots can reduce fatigue, making it easier for women to navigate challenging terrains without straining their feet.
  • Adjustable Features: Look for boots with adjustable laces or straps to ensure a snug fit and prevent movement that can lead to blisters.
  • Water Resistance: Selecting water-resistant jungle boots can keep feet dry in wet conditions, which is vital for comfort and hygiene.

Proper sizing ensures that the boots fit snugly without being too tight, which is especially important since many jungle boots are designed with a unisex fit. Women should measure their feet accurately and consider styles that offer half sizes or specific women’s options.

Arch support is critical for maintaining comfort during long periods of walking or standing. Boots that provide support tailored to different arch types can help alleviate foot pain and fatigue, making them a better choice for women’s unique foot shapes.

Breathable materials, such as mesh or moisture-wicking fabrics, allow for better airflow, reducing the likelihood of blisters and fungal infections. In humid jungles, having boots that can keep feet cool and dry is therefore essential for prolonged wear.

Weight distribution plays a significant role in how comfortable the boots will be over long distances. Lighter boots can help maintain energy levels and reduce the risk of foot strain, especially when navigating uneven terrain.

Adjustable features like laces and straps help create a customized fit, which is important for preventing blisters and discomfort. A well-fitted boot that doesn’t shift during movement can significantly enhance stability and reduce the risk of injuries.

Water resistance in jungle boots is vital for keeping feet dry in wet conditions, which can help prevent discomfort and health issues related to prolonged moisture exposure. Boots that effectively repel water allow women to navigate through puddles and streams without worry.
